Kristina Varaksina

Photographer Overview

Kristina Varaksina received her Master’s in Photography from the Academy of Art University, San Francisco, in 2013. She currently lives and works in London.

In her personal work, Varaksina explores the vulnerabilities, insecurities and self-search of a woman and an artist. Through visual symbolism, carefully curated colour palettes and cinematic lighting she reflects the strongest emotions she and her subjects experience.
Varaksina sees her job as a photographer to make “ordinary” women more visible and therefore, more valuable.


Awards and recognitions: Lens Culture Portrait 2022 Finalist, AOP Open Awards 2021 finalist, BBA Berlin 2021 3rd place Winner, Lens Culture Portrait 2021 2nd Place Winner, Winner in Portrait of Britain 2020, Lens Culture Critics Choice 2020 Winner, BJP Portrait of Humanity 2020 Shortlist, AOP Open Awards 2020 Silver, IPA 2020 Honourable mention, PX3 Prix de la Photographie, Communications Arts, Int’l Photography Awards, APA National Award, Vogue.it BEST OF, Digital Photo Magazine, Applied Arts, CMYK Magazine, PDN Faces, PDN Emerging.

Galleries representing fine artwork: BBA Berlin, Lumas, Berlin. Brownie, Shanghai. Hello World, Vienna. Themes&Projects, San Francisco.

Commissions include TIME, The Guardian, The Telegraph, Harper’s Bazaar, L’Officiel.
